    An Empty Cup, a Silent Promise

    Someone once told me,A vessel’s worth is not in its fill,But in the space, calm and still.An empty cup, a silent promise,Whatever it is, whatever might be,The unknown shapes our destiny.In any aspect, vast or slight,Emptiness births clarity and light.Potential thrives in still, soft grooves,In quiet moments, wisdom moves.
